Alumina/Silica Fiber (Al₂O₃80/SiO₂20) exhibits a unique combination of high-temperature capability, low thermal conductivity, and superior mechanical resilience, making it an excellent choice for thermal insulation and reinforcement in extreme environments. The balanced composition of alumina and silica enhances thermal shock resistance and chemical stability, while also enabling flexibility in fibrous form. This fiber is widely used in aerospace, metallurgy, and energy sectors, particularly for furnace linings, high-performance composites, and protective thermal blankets. Specific technologies benefiting from this material include lightweight structural composites for high-temperature aerospace components, thermal shields in metallurgical processing, and insulation in advanced energy systems. Its role in research spans next-generation refractory composites and energy-efficient insulation materials, offering a platform for innovation in reducing thermal losses while maintaining structural integrity.
